Interest Income

Southwest Airlines Interest Income decreased by 30.3% to $23M in Q1 2026 compared to the prior quarter. Year-over-year, this metric declined by 72.6%, from $84M to $23M. Over 4 years (FY 2021 to FY 2025), Interest Income shows an upward trend with a 99.3% CAGR. This is a positive signal — higher values indicate stronger performance for this metric.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is Southwest Airlines's interest income?
Southwest Airlines (LUV) reported interest income of $23M in Q1 2026.
How has Southwest Airlines's interest income changed year-over-year?
Southwest Airlines's interest income decreased by 72.6% year-over-year, from $84M to $23M.
What is the long-term trend for Southwest Airlines's interest income?
Over 4 years (2021 to 2025), Southwest Airlines's interest income has grown at a 99.3%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$13M to $205M.
What does interest income mean?
The total interest earned from the company's cash holdings and financial investments.
